import * as Diff from 'diff';
import type VaultkeeperAIPlugin from 'main';
import { Resolve } from './DependencyService';
import { Services } from './Services';
import type { EventService } from './EventService';
import { Event } from 'Enums/Event';
import type { Diff2HtmlUIConfig } from 'diff2html/lib/ui/js/diff2html-ui';
import { ColorSchemeType, OutputFormatType } from 'diff2html/lib/types';
import { Component } from 'obsidian';
import { AbortService } from './AbortService';
import { Exception } from 'Helpers/Exception';
interface DiffResult {
accepted: boolean;
suggestion?: string;
}
export class DiffService extends Component {
private readonly plugin: VaultkeeperAIPlugin;
private readonly eventService: EventService;
private readonly abortService: AbortService;
private diffResolve?: (result: DiffResult) => void;
private ongoingDiff: boolean = false;
public constructor() {
super();
this.plugin = Resolve<VaultkeeperAIPlugin>(Services.VaultkeeperAIPlugin);
this.eventService = Resolve<EventService>(Services.EventService);
this.abortService = Resolve<AbortService>(Services.AbortService);
this.registerEvent(this.eventService.on(Event.DiffClosed, () => {
this.cancelPendingDiff();
}));
}
public applyPatch(source: string, patch: string): string | false | Error {
try {
return Diff.applyPatch(source, patch);
} catch (error) {
return Exception.new(error);
}
}
public async requestDiff(oldFileName: string, newFileName: string, oldContent: string, newContent: string): Promise<DiffResult> {
const diffString = this.createDiffString(oldFileName, newFileName, oldContent, newContent);
const outputFormat: OutputFormatType = "line-by-line";
const config: Diff2HtmlUIConfig = {
drawFileList: false,
matching: "words",
outputFormat: outputFormat,
highlight: true,
fileListToggle: false,
fileContentToggle: false,
synchronisedScroll: true,
colorScheme: ColorSchemeType.AUTO
};
this.ongoingDiff = true;
const signal = this.abortService.signal();
return new Promise<DiffResult>((resolve, reject) => {
if (signal.aborted) {
this.finishDiff();
reject(this.abortService.reason());
return;
}
const abortHandler = () => {
this.finishDiff();
reject(this.abortService.reason());
};
signal.addEventListener("abort", abortHandler, { once: true });
this.diffResolve = (result: DiffResult) => {
signal.removeEventListener("abort", abortHandler);
resolve(result);
};
void this.plugin.activateDiffView(diffString, config);
this.eventService.trigger(Event.DiffOpened);
});
}
public onAccept() {
if (this.diffResolve) {
this.diffResolve({ accepted: true });
}
this.finishDiff();
}
public onReject() {
if (this.diffResolve) {
this.diffResolve({ accepted: false });
}
this.finishDiff();
}
public onSuggest(suggestion: string) {
if (this.diffResolve) {
this.diffResolve({ accepted: false, suggestion: suggestion });
}
this.finishDiff();
}
private cancelPendingDiff() {
if (this.ongoingDiff) {
if (this.diffResolve) {
this.diffResolve({ accepted: false });
}
this.finishDiff();
}
}
private createDiffString(oldFileName: string, newFileName: string, oldContent: string, newContent: string): string {
return Diff.createTwoFilesPatch(oldFileName, newFileName, oldContent, newContent, undefined, undefined, { context: Infinity });
}
private finishDiff() {
this.ongoingDiff = false;
this.diffResolve = undefined;
this.eventService.trigger(Event.DiffClosed);
}
}
